Air Resource Heat Pumps vs. Geothermal Warmth Pumps



When taking into consideration Air Resource Heat Pumps vs. Geothermal Warmth Pumps for your home, there are crucial distinctions to remember.

Air Resource Warm Pumps essence warm from the outside air and are a lot more common due to reduced installment costs. They function well in modest climates but may be much less efficient in severe cold.

Geothermal Warm Pumps, on the other hand, use warmth from the ground, giving constant heating and cooling down no matter exterior temperatures. While they've greater ahead of time prices, they're more energy-efficient in the future and have a longer life-span.

Air Resource Warm Pumps are easier to mount and preserve compared to Geothermal Heat Pumps, which require even more elaborate underground setups. Nevertheless, Geothermal Warm Pumps offer greater power cost savings in time, making them a much more eco-friendly option.



Consider your climate, budget plan, and long-lasting objectives when picking in between these 2 types of heatpump for your home.

Effectiveness Comparison: Police and HSPF Rankings



For a complete contrast of Air Resource Heat Pumps and Geothermal Warm Pumps, recognizing their efficiency through police officer (Coefficient of Performance) and HSPF (Home Heating Seasonal Performance Element) ratings is essential. Police officer determines the heating or cooling output of a heat pump contrasted to the energy it consumes. A greater COP shows far better performance. Geothermal Warmth Pumps commonly have greater police officer worths than Air Resource Warm Pumps, making them much more energy-efficient.

On the other hand, HSPF focuses particularly on the home heating performance of a heatpump over a whole home heating season. It takes into consideration aspects like defrost cycles and standby losses. dc installation services have a tendency to have higher HSPF rankings due to their stable below ground temperature source.

When contrasting effectiveness based on police and HSPF scores, Geothermal Warmth Pumps typically come out on top. They supply greater effectiveness levels, which can result in reduced power bills with time.

However, upfront prices might be greater for Geothermal Warmth Pumps, so it's vital to think about both effectiveness and price variables when choosing the most effective choice for your home.

Cost Evaluation: Installation and Operation Costs



Taking into consideration the expenses connected with both installation and operation is essential when contrasting Air Resource Heat Pumps and Geothermal Heat Pumps. Air Source Heat Pumps are typically more affordable to install ahead of time compared to Geothermal Warmth Pumps. The installation of a Geothermal Heat Pump entails more intricate below ground work, making it a more expensive option initially. Nevertheless, Geothermal Heat Pumps are recognized for their greater effectiveness, which can cause reduced functional prices gradually.

When it concerns functional expenses, Geothermal Warmth Pumps tend to be more cost-effective in the long run due to their higher effectiveness and lower power intake. They can give significant financial savings on cooling and heating expenses, countering the greater installment prices.

Air Resource Heat Pumps, while having lower in advance prices, could cause slightly higher functional expenses because they aren't as efficient as their geothermal counterparts.

Inevitably, the very best choice for your home depends upon your spending plan, long-lasting energy goals, and details home heating and cooling down requirements. Think about both the installment and operation costs carefully before choosing.
